The general formula of a carboxylic acid is R–COOH, with R referring to the rest of the (possibly quite large) molecule. Carboxylic Acid occur widely and include the amino acids (which make up proteins) and acetic acid (which is part of vinegar and occurs in metabolism).

Download Free Research Report PDF @ http://bit.ly/2mlgg3y #25FurandicarboxylicAcid #MarketAnalysis 2,5-Furandicarboxylic acid (FDCA) is an organic chemical compound consisting of two carboxylic acid groups attached to a central furan ring. It was first reported as dehydromucic acid by Rudolph Fittig and Heinzelmann in 1876, who produced it via the action of concentrated hydrobromic acid upon mucic acid. It is soluble in water under alkaline conditions and is a white powdery solid under acidic conditions.2,5-Furandicarboxylic acid (FDCA) is considered a highly promising bio-based alternative to terephthalic acid for the production of polymers.It is an important monomer for the preparation of corrosion-resistant plastics.In 2019, the market size of 2,5-Furandicarboxylic Acid (FDCA) is 260 million US$ and it will reach 420 million US$ in 2025, growing at a CAGR of 6.5% during forecast period 2019-2025. Butyric acid is a colourless saturated short-chain fatty acid, having an unpleasant odour. It is a carboxylic acid found in butter, cheese and has an unpleasant odour and sour taste, with a sweetish after taste. This fatty acid occurs in the form of esters in animal fats and plant oils. It is a short chain fatty acid found in milk, especially in goat, sheep and buffalo milk.

Glyoxylic acid or oxoacetic acid is an organic compound that is both an aldehyde and a carboxylic acid. Glyoxylic acid is a liquid and is an intermediate of the glyoxylate cycle, which enables certain organisms to convert fatty acids into carbohydrates.Glyoxylic acid, a colorless to yellowish liquid, has wide applications, such as: as key intermediate in the pharma or agro industries, flavors and fragrances, dyestuff and fine chemicals, cosmetics as in hair straightening formulations. It can be manufactured industrially by nitric acid oxidation of glyoxal, and was also manufactured by oxidative cleaveage of maleic acid methyl ester by ozone, or manufactured through electroreduction of oxalic acid. For the most manufacturers of glyoxylic acid, nitric acid oxidation of glyoxal is the preferred manufacturing method.

About Amino AcidAmino acids are organic compounds made up of amines (NH2) and carboxylic acid (COOH) functional groups. They act as building blocks of proteins and as metabolic intermediates. Amino acids are the core of all biological processes, as they are crucial for every metabolic process. Additionally, they aid in the development, repair, and maintenance of body tissues.Even though the human body can produce some amino acids, it requires certain other essential amino acids that can only be obtained by consuming food rich in them. Amino acids such as lysine, methionine, and threonine are used as animal feed additives. Certain amino acids such as proline, glycine, and arginine are also used as ingredients in pharmaceutical products.
Azelaic acid is a crystalline, opaque-white solid, soluble in hot water, alcohols, diethyl ether, and other polar solvents. The two carboxyl groups of azelaic acid limit its solubility in nonpolar solvents such as naphtha or carbon tetrachloride

Download free PDF Sample@ https://bit.ly/2ZeaIcs #ChemicalsAndMaterials #Chemicals #MarketAnalysis #ImmobilizedTrypsin Immobilized Trypsin provides a fast and convenient method for digesting a range of concentrations of purified protein or complex protein mixtures. Digested peptides are easily separated from the Immobilized Trypsin as they flow through the spin column into the collection tube. Immobilized Trypsin is easily removed from the peptide solution because the trypsin does not pass though the column frit. Trypsin is a proteolytic enzyme, which cleaves at the carboxyl side of positively charged Lysine (Lys) and Arginine (Arg).

Malonic acid, also called propanedioic acid, is a precursor to specialty polyesters. It is a dibasic organic acid whose diethyl ester is used in syntheses of vitamins B1 and B6, barbiturates, and numerous other valuable compounds. Malonic acid itself is rather unstable and has few applications. Its calcium salt occurs in beetroot, but the acid itself is usually prepared by hydrolyzing diethyl malonate. It undergoes the usual reactions of carboxylic acids as well as facile cleavage into acetic acid and carbon dioxide.

It is a carboxylic acid, which is oily and colorless, and occurs in many dairy products like milk, cheese, and butter. Butyric acid has esters and salts known as butanoates and butyrates. It exhibits an unpleasant smell and also has an acrid taste. It is used in stink bombs for its pungent smell. Some of its derivative chemicals and esters are sweet smelling.
